테스트 사이트 - 개발 중인 베타 버전입니다

차이가 뭔가요? 채택완료

너모야민쯩까 9년 전 조회 4,195

varchar(255) 랑 text와 차이가 뭘까요? 

너무 몰라 죄송해요,,,유유

 

댓글을 작성하려면 로그인이 필요합니다.

답변 3개

채택된 답변
+20 포인트
ceoseo
9년 전

varchar(255)는 255바이트. 즉, 최고 255자까지 가능합니다.

text는 65535바이트입니다. 255자를 넘는 텍스트를 입력하려면 text 타입으로 하시면 됩니다.

로그인 후 평가할 수 있습니다

답변에 대한 댓글 1개

너모야민쯩까
9년 전
말끔하게 해결되었습니다. 감사합니다~

댓글을 작성하려면 로그인이 필요합니다.

참고로 요즘은 mysql 버전이 5.0.3 이상이기에 varchar를 쓰시면 text처럼 65,535까지 가능합니다.

근데 그게 버릇처럼 굳어져서 아직 255로 쓰지만요. ㅎㅎ 

로그인 후 평가할 수 있습니다

답변에 대한 댓글 1개

너모야민쯩까
9년 전
아 그런 부분도 있군요~ 관심 감사합니다~

댓글을 작성하려면 로그인이 필요합니다.

d
9년 전

varchar(255) 같은경우는 255자가까지 데이터가 들어갈수있고

text같은경우는 그보다 훨씬많이 글자수가 들어갈수있어요 

로그인 후 평가할 수 있습니다

답변에 대한 댓글 1개

너모야민쯩까
9년 전
감사합니다~고민이 해결되었습니다.

댓글을 작성하려면 로그인이 필요합니다.

답변을 작성하려면 로그인이 필요합니다.

로그인